package com.amazonaws.services.braket.model;

import java.io.Serializable;
import javax.annotation.Generated;
import com.amazonaws.protocol.StructuredPojo;
import com.amazonaws.protocol.ProtocolMarshaller;

/**
 * 

* Contains information about the Python scripts used for entry and by an Amazon Braket job. *

* * @see AWS API * Documentation */ @Generated("com.amazonaws:aws-java-sdk-code-generator") public class ScriptModeConfig implements Serializable, Cloneable, StructuredPojo { /** *

* The type of compression used by the Python scripts for an Amazon Braket job. *

*/ private String compressionType; /** *

* The path to the Python script that serves as the entry point for an Amazon Braket job. *

*/ private String entryPoint; /** *

* The URI that specifies the S3 path to the Python script module that contains the training script used by an * Amazon Braket job. *

*/ private String s3Uri; /** *

* The type of compression used by the Python scripts for an Amazon Braket job. *

* * @param compressionType * The type of compression used by the Python scripts for an Amazon Braket job. * @see CompressionType */ public void setCompressionType(String compressionType) { this.compressionType = compressionType; } /** *

* The type of compression used by the Python scripts for an Amazon Braket job. *

* * @return The type of compression used by the Python scripts for an Amazon Braket job. * @see CompressionType */ public String getCompressionType() { return this.compressionType; } /** *

* The type of compression used by the Python scripts for an Amazon Braket job. *

* * @param compressionType * The type of compression used by the Python scripts for an Amazon Braket job. * @return Returns a reference to this object so that method calls can be chained together. * @see CompressionType */ public ScriptModeConfig withCompressionType(String compressionType) { setCompressionType(compressionType); return this; } /** *

* The type of compression used by the Python scripts for an Amazon Braket job. *

* * @param compressionType * The type of compression used by the Python scripts for an Amazon Braket job. * @return Returns a reference to this object so that method calls can be chained together. * @see CompressionType */ public ScriptModeConfig withCompressionType(CompressionType compressionType) { this.compressionType = compressionType.toString(); return this; } /** *

* The path to the Python script that serves as the entry point for an Amazon Braket job. *

* * @param entryPoint * The path to the Python script that serves as the entry point for an Amazon Braket job. */ public void setEntryPoint(String entryPoint) { this.entryPoint = entryPoint; } /** *

* The path to the Python script that serves as the entry point for an Amazon Braket job. *

* * @return The path to the Python script that serves as the entry point for an Amazon Braket job. */ public String getEntryPoint() { return this.entryPoint; } /** *

* The path to the Python script that serves as the entry point for an Amazon Braket job. *

* * @param entryPoint * The path to the Python script that serves as the entry point for an Amazon Braket job. * @return Returns a reference to this object so that method calls can be chained together. */ public ScriptModeConfig withEntryPoint(String entryPoint) { setEntryPoint(entryPoint); return this; } /** *

* The URI that specifies the S3 path to the Python script module that contains the training script used by an * Amazon Braket job. *

* * @param s3Uri * The URI that specifies the S3 path to the Python script module that contains the training script used by * an Amazon Braket job. */ public void setS3Uri(String s3Uri) { this.s3Uri = s3Uri; } /** *

* The URI that specifies the S3 path to the Python script module that contains the training script used by an * Amazon Braket job. *

* * @return The URI that specifies the S3 path to the Python script module that contains the training script used by * an Amazon Braket job. */ public String getS3Uri() { return this.s3Uri; } /** *

* The URI that specifies the S3 path to the Python script module that contains the training script used by an * Amazon Braket job. *

* * @param s3Uri * The URI that specifies the S3 path to the Python script module that contains the training script used by * an Amazon Braket job. * @return Returns a reference to this object so that method calls can be chained together. */ public ScriptModeConfig withS3Uri(String s3Uri) { setS3Uri(s3Uri); return this; } /** * Returns a string representation of this object. This is useful for testing and debugging. Sensitive data will be * redacted from this string using a placeholder value. * * @return A string representation of this object. * * @see java.lang.Object#toString() */ @Override public String toString() { StringBuilder sb = new StringBuilder(); sb.append("{"); if (getCompressionType() != null) sb.append("CompressionType: ").append(getCompressionType()).append(","); if (getEntryPoint() != null) sb.append("EntryPoint: ").append(getEntryPoint()).append(","); if (getS3Uri() != null) sb.append("S3Uri: ").append(getS3Uri()); sb.append("}"); return sb.toString(); } @Override public boolean equals(Object obj) { if (this == obj) return true; if (obj == null) return false; if (obj instanceof ScriptModeConfig == false) return false; ScriptModeConfig other = (ScriptModeConfig) obj; if (other.getCompressionType() == null ^ this.getCompressionType() == null) return false; if (other.getCompressionType() != null && other.getCompressionType().equals(this.getCompressionType()) == false) return false; if (other.getEntryPoint() == null ^ this.getEntryPoint() == null) return false; if (other.getEntryPoint() != null && other.getEntryPoint().equals(this.getEntryPoint()) == false) return false; if (other.getS3Uri() == null ^ this.getS3Uri() == null) return false; if (other.getS3Uri() != null && other.getS3Uri().equals(this.getS3Uri()) == false) return false; return true; } @Override public int hashCode() { final int prime = 31; int hashCode = 1; hashCode = prime * hashCode + ((getCompressionType() == null) ? 0 : getCompressionType().hashCode()); hashCode = prime * hashCode + ((getEntryPoint() == null) ? 0 : getEntryPoint().hashCode()); hashCode = prime * hashCode + ((getS3Uri() == null) ? 0 : getS3Uri().hashCode()); return hashCode; } @Override public ScriptModeConfig clone() { try { return (ScriptModeConfig) super.clone(); } catch (CloneNotSupportedException e) { throw new IllegalStateException("Got a CloneNotSupportedException from Object.clone() " + "even though we're Cloneable!", e); } } @com.amazonaws.annotation.SdkInternalApi @Override public void marshall(ProtocolMarshaller protocolMarshaller) { com.amazonaws.services.braket.model.transform.ScriptModeConfigMarshaller.getInstance().marshall(this, protocolMarshaller); } }
